The Fool & Ten of Swords Tarot combinations and meaning
Embracing New Beginnings with Challenges
The combination of The Fool and Ten of Swords suggests a journey filled with both potential and pain. The Fool represents new beginnings, spontaneity, and the thrill of taking risks. However, the Ten of Swords indicates betrayal, failure, or loss. Together, they remind us that new paths may come with difficulties that need to be faced head-on, encouraging growth and resilience through tough experiences.
New Love Amidst Heartache
In love, this combination indicates the possibility of new romance emerging after heartbreak. The Fool urges you to be open to love and to take a leap of faith, while the Ten of Swords serves as a reminder of past pain. Healing is essential, and moving forward can lead to fulfilling relationships if you embrace change.
Taking Risks at Work and Facing Obstacles
In a career context, this pair suggests that while you might be starting fresh or pursuing a new opportunity (The Fool), there could be challenges or setbacks (Ten of Swords) along the way. It's a call to embrace your adventurous side and take calculated risks, while also preparing for potential obstacles ahead in your professional journey.
Financial Adventures and Hardships
Financially, the combination hints at embarking on a new venture or investment (The Fool), but warns of potential losses or poor decisions (Ten of Swords). It's crucial to be cautious and well-informed when taking financial risks, allowing you to navigate through possible challenges and emerge stronger.
